Tests used for an ADD assessment

A test for adults can comprise several tests. These tests are used to test for impulsivity or attention problems. A comprehensive assessment should include standardized behavior rating scales for ADHD and interviews with the patient.

FDA-cleared computer tests like the Test of Variables of Attention, are used to screen for adhd assessment for adults london. It measures visual and auditory processing abilities. Children and adults take the test for 21.6 minutes. They are given basic geometric shapes to be used as targets during the test. When the target is displayed, they must press the micro switch. They should not press the micro switch if they hear a toneor other stimulus.

The Quantified Behavior Test (QbTest) is a mixture of attention and impulsivity measures as well as motion tracking analysis. It is a diagnostic tool that can be useful in evaluating the effects of stimulant medications. It can also be used to detect fidgetiness. Additionally, it can reveal the effectiveness of neurofeedback training.
